流程控制 一、流程控制 ? 流程控制 就是控制流程,具体控制程序的执行流程,而程序的执行流程分为三种结构:顺序结构、分支结构(用if判断)、循环结构(用到while与for) ? 主要目的 就是让计算帮助人类工作,所以,编写的程序需要有判断力 ? 语法结构 :python是通过 缩进 来决定代码的归 ...
分类:
编程语言 时间:
2019-11-04 19:56:58
阅读次数:
64
流程控制(if while for)流程控制即控制流程,具体指控制程序的执行流程,而程序的执行流程分为三种结构:顺序结构(之前我们的写的代码都是顺序结构)分支结构(用到if判断),循环结构(用到while与for)什么是分支结构? 分支结构就是根据条件判断的真假去执行不同分支对应的子代码为什么要用分 ...
分类:
其他好文 时间:
2019-11-04 17:56:53
阅读次数:
115
20182330《程序设计与设计结构》 第八周学习总结 [toc] 教材学习内容总结 周一: 数据结构 逻辑结构: 线性结构:线性表、栈、队、串:特殊的线性结构、数组 非线性结构:树结构、图结构 物理(存储)结构: 顺序结构、链式结构、索引结构、散列结构 数据运算:插入、删除、修改、查找、排序 1. ...
分类:
其他好文 时间:
2019-11-04 17:53:50
阅读次数:
103
程序从程序入口进入,到程序执行结束,大体是按照顺序结构执行语句、函数或代码块,掌握程序的结构,有利于把握程序的主体框架。 1、顺序结构--最常见的结构 顺序结构的程序设计是最简单的,只要按照解决问题的顺序写出相应的语句就行,它的执行顺序是自上而下,依次执行。程序的执行严格按照程序语句在程序中出现的先 ...
分类:
编程语言 时间:
2019-11-03 14:47:22
阅读次数:
67
4.流程控制 4.1关于代码的三种结构 ①顺序结构 程序从上到下逐行地执行,中间没有任何判断和跳转。 ②分支结构 根据条件,选择性地执行某段代码。有if…else和switch-case两种分支语句。 ③循环结构 根据循环条件,重复性的执行某段代码。有while(){}、do{}while()、fo ...
分类:
编程语言 时间:
2019-11-02 09:18:57
阅读次数:
98
一般情况:顺序结构,必须等待前面的操作完成(两个人说话,a把所有话说完,b才能继续说) 并发:同一时间段处理多个任务的能力(两人说话,支持你一言我一语的交流,两人在一个时间段内都有说话,是基于时间段内的同时发生) 并发又有同步和互斥 互斥:不能同时使用临界资源(有一个共享资源--话筒,两人必须用话筒 ...
分类:
编程语言 时间:
2019-10-29 14:08:20
阅读次数:
127
数据结构 逻辑结构 集合结构 线性结构 树形结构 图形结构 物理结构(存储结构) 顺序结构 链式结构 逻辑结构 集合结构 线性结构 树形结构 图形结构 物理结构(存储结构) 顺序结构 链式结构 集合结构:集合结构中的元素是平等的一种关系,相互独立 线性结构:线性结构中的元素是一对一的关系 树形结构: ...
分类:
其他好文 时间:
2019-10-29 11:52:42
阅读次数:
100
三种循环语句 程序的结构: 顺序结构 分支结构 循环结构:重复 while(){}循环 while:条件为true时,执行 循环的三要素: 次数的记录:计数器 停止(执行)条件:布尔值 次数的改变:改变计数器(随着循环改变) 注意:计数器提前声明,计数器的改变要在循环中,条件准备 do{}while ...
分类:
其他好文 时间:
2019-10-27 16:42:51
阅读次数:
70
计算机程序在解决某个具体问题时,包括三种情形,即顺序执行所有的语句、选择执行部分的语句和循环执行部分语句,这正好对应着程序设计中的三种程序执行结构流程:顺序结构、选择结构和循环结构。 事实证明,任何一个能用计算机解决的问题,只要应用这三种基本结构来写出的程序都能解决。Python语言当然也具有这三种 ...
分类:
其他好文 时间:
2019-10-17 13:35:11
阅读次数:
80
目录: 一、程序流程控制 二、顺序结构 三、分支语句1:if-else结构 四、分支语句2:switch-case结构 五、循环结构 六、循环结构1:for循环 /* 黄金分割线 */ 一、程序流程控制 > 顺序结构 ● 自上逐行向下执行 >分支结构 ● 根据条件,选择性执行某段代码 ● 有if-e ...
分类:
编程语言 时间:
2019-10-16 17:30:30
阅读次数:
72